About Christopher D Stave
Christopher D Stave is a scholar working on Hepatology, Horticulture and Applied Microbiology and Biotechnology, having authored 78 papers that have together received 5.2k indexed citations. Recurring topics across this work include Liver Disease Diagnosis and Treatment (12 papers), Diet, Metabolism, and Disease (6 papers) and Hepatitis C virus research (6 papers). The work is most often cited by research in Hepatology (553 citations), Applied Psychology (337 citations) and Physiology (1.4k citations). Christopher D Stave has collaborated with scholars based in United States, China and United Kingdom. Frequent co-authors include Dena M Bravata, Vandana Sundaram, Crystal Smith-Spangler, Ingram Olkin, Allison Gienger, John R. Sirard, Robyn Lewis, Nancy D. Lin, Mindie H. Nguyen and Ramsey Cheung. Their work appears in journals such as JAMA, Journal of Clinical Oncology and Annals of Internal Medicine.
